<p>A method and apparatus for measuring volume correction in a gas pipeline (12) using a variable volume chamber (19) where the gas is sampled at the temperature and pressure of gas (11) in the pipeline (12). A portion of a known volume of sample gas is released and a change of volume in the sample chamber (19) is measured with respect to time, while maintaining temperature and pressure at pipeline conditions. The sample gas is then measured by a molar flow meter (34, 35, 36, 37) for molar flow rate at near base conditions. A microcontroller (31) calculates the molar density of the gas. Because the molar density of the gas has been measured at pipeline conditions, it can be multiplied by volumetric flow rate in the pipeline to provide base volumetric flow rate of the pipeline gas. A heating analyzer (38) is provided to determine heat content of the gas, and this is multiplied by volumetric flow rate to determine energy flow rate.</p> |
